Examples play a significant role at construction and reconstruction of math concepts. Good educational examples like a clear monitor, act as means for connecting learners, teachers and concepts. This study examines math teachers’ perception of examples and how they could be used in the process of teaching a concept. The research method employed in this study was a qualitative survey method. The research population consisted of all high school math teachers of Markazi province in the academic year 89-90 and 75 randomly selected teachers participated as the sample. The results showed that teachers are aware of the necessity of the use of examples, but they do not have sufficient knowledge of educational examples and their example space is not sufficiently developed. Most of the teachers consider examples as useful and necessary tool and as a common understandable language for learners. But it seems that they do not consider theorems, problems, definitions, proofs and reasoning as examples. Teachers pointed out some characteristics for educational examples such as clarity and simplicity, math accuracy, being in accordance with students’ learning ability and being measurable, but a large number of them neglected important characteristics such as generalizability, the availability and richness and power of a math example. Findings also indicated that most of participating teachers used examples in parts of teaching process such as conceptualizing or teaching procedures.

Identifying the constraining factors of production and yield gap is very important. Therefore; this research was performed to identify the production constraining factors of local rice cultivars. All management practices from nursery preparation to harvesting stages for 100 paddy fields of local rice cultivars were recorded through field studies, in Sari, from 2015-2016. In the CPA, the actual and calculated potential yield were 4495 and 5703 kg/ha, respectively and the gap was 1221 kg/ha. The yield gap caused by number of top-dressing variables was 324 kg/ha, equal to 27% of the total yield gap. The yield gap related to previous year of legumes cultivation was 218 kg ha-1, equal to 18% of the total yield variation. Among the 10 variables entered in the CPA model, the effects of top-dress fertilizer application and its application frequency and foliar application were remarkable, which could compensate a significant part of the yield gap (444 kg/ha, 37% of total) in the farmers’ fields by managing these variables. According to boundary line analysis (BLA) finding, actual yield mean on the basis of optimal limit related to 12 variables under study was 5369 kg/ha, with 881 kg/ha yield gap . Mean relative yield and relative yield gap for 12 variables (transplanting date, seedling age, number of seedlings per hill, planting density, nitrogen and phosphorous per hectare, nitrogen before transplanting, harvesting date, lodging problem, pest problem, diseases problem and weeds problem) were 83.64 and 16.35 kg/ha, respectively. Based on the finding, it can be stated that the model precision is appropriate and can be applied for both estimation of the quantity of yield gap and determining the portion of each restricting yield variables.

Estimates of technical inefficiency in agricultural production are suspect so long as variations exist in production technology among the sampled farmers. Traditional methods of dealing with these technological differences risk attributing "technology gaps" to technical inefficiency between farms, pointing to the need to undertake a metafrontier analysis that allows technology gaps to be distinguished from technical inefficiency. Using farm-level data on the production of three different varieties of pistachio trees in Iran, we outline two criteria to justify its use: an inability in farmers to switch between production technologies except in the long term, and satisfaction of statistical tests on metafrontier coefficients. The application of metafrontier analysis enabled technical efficiency scores to be corrected for differences in production capacity imposed by tree variety. Results reveal that there is very little difference in technical efficiency between farms growing the different tree varieties. But they show that ignoring the production constraints imposed by variety choice could overstate the scope for farmers to improve their technical performance by adopting better farming practices. The results also indicate that it is misleading to compare the performance of different tree varieties on the basis of yield per hectare alone.

The lack of Quranic approaches in the production of Quran-based humanities is still felt, despite the predominance of the philosophical approach in critical approaches to modern humanities, which has become very common in the Islamic world and in Iran for several decades. It seems that the capacity of the method of thematic exegesis (al-Tafsīr al-mawdū'ī, Arabic: التفسیر الموضوعیّ) in this regard, can be used to bring the Holy Quran into the field of humanities. Thematic exegesis, according to whether its subject is inside or outside the Qur'an, has several functions in criticizing the structure of modern knowledge and scientific research, as well as the production of Islamic humanities. It is possible to make use of thematic exegesis of the inside of the Holy Book of Quran in order to “fundamental criticism” of the general fundamentals of humanities -the fundamentals of epistemology, axiology, ontology and anthropology- and it is also possible to use thematic exegesis for constructing and producing foundation of humanities obtained from the Holy Quran. It is used by thematic interpretation exegesis of the outside of the Holy Book of Quran -such as Shahīd (martyr) Sadr’s interrogational approach- to answer the problems of humanities and this process faces challenges such as the complexity and multiplicity of the “subject” of the humanities that exist in modern terminology of this field. This study was conducted during summer and winter of 2018- 2019 in the agricultural research field of Shahid Chamran University. Experimental design was split- plot based on RCBD with three replications. The main plot was the type of agricultural system in three levels including conventional (Conv), organic (Org) and sustainable (Sust) (integrated between Conv and Org) and sup- plot was the type of pre- cultivated crop in sequence with wheat including cultivation of mung bean (M- W), corn (C- W), sesame (S- W) and fallow (F- W). Yield quantity (yield and its component) and quality (grain protein), an estimate of photosynthesis matter transfer index of wheat and soil organic carbon (SOC) after one double-cropping were measured. The result showed that the highest (545.04 g/m2) and the lowest (409.28 g/m2) seed yields were obtained in Conv and Org respectively. In contract, with the changing type of system from Conv to Org, grain protein was increased significantly (from 8.3 to 9.6 %). In addition, the highest (535.47 g/m2) yield of wheat was obtained from M- W double cropping. On the other hands the highest remobilization and current photosynthesis matter were obtained in the organic agricultural system with M- W and conventional with M- W double cropping. The situation of SOC showed that the highest (33.18 mg/g) SOC was obtained in the organic agricultural system with C- W double cropping. The reason for improving SOC in the organic and sustainable agricultural system was application of organic matter (compost and vermicompost) and crop residue management. Totally, from the crop ecology point of view, sustainable agricultural method with a sequence of M- W was the most desirable system.

Medicinal plants contain active ingredients in one or some of their organs. Squalene is one of the active ingredients that prevent heart attacks and cardiovascular diseases and protect the body from some cancers. The aim of the present study was to investigate the presence of squalene in a number of medicinal plants. In this experiment, the plant oils were extracted and measured using Bligh & Dyer with minor changes. TLC (thin layer chromatography) was used to identify squalene. Comparison of TLC of standard squalene with TLC of the investigated medicinal plant samples showed that Caryophillium aromaticus, Descurainia sophia, Portulaca Oleracea, Papaver somniferum and Nigella Sativa contained squalene. Although the percentage of Papaver somniferum and Nigella Sativa seed oil was higher than other medicinal plants, the squalane spot of clove plant had a higher intensity of color and this indicates a higher concentration of squalene in this plant.

Two experiments were designed to investigate how students use examples and procedures to solve algebra word problems. In the first study the effect of teaching through example and procedure was investigated on the students algebra word problem solving performance.Participants were 73 girl students in their 3rd year of math-physics branch, secondary school. They were randomly assigned to three groups. The first group was instructed by presenting simple examples,the second group by procedure, whereas the third group was instructed by both procedure and simple example. No significant difference was observed in the performance of the three groups. In Experiment 2, three new conditions consisting of complex example, complex and simple examples,and complex example plus procedure were added to two of the conditions in Study 1, namely simple example condition and procedure condition. The 122 participants in Study 2 had similar characteristics to subjects in the first study. Results indicated that there were statistically significant differences among the five groups. Results show that adding examples at different levels of complexity to procedure improves the capability of students problem solving, which is in harmony with empirical and theoretical background.

In this paper, we investigate pseudo-Riemannian manifolds those eigenvalues of the Weyl conformal Jacobi operators are constant on the unit sphere bundles. Using a result of [4], we give an explicit construction of conformally Osserman manifold which is not locally conformally flat.
